Solinst 101D DrawDown Water Level Meter
The Solinst 101D DrawDown Water Level Meter shares the same P7 probe and laser-marked flat tape as the standard 101 Water Level Meter, but adds a toggle switch that reverses the circuit logic. In standard mode, the buzzer and light activate when the probe touches water, just like a conventional water level meter. In drawdown mode, the logic flips so the buzzer and light activate when the probe is in air — signaling the moment water drops below the probe — which lets an operator continuously monitor water level decline during pumping without having to raise and lower the probe to find the current level.
- Toggle switch reverses buzzer/light logic between water-level and drawdown modes
- Drawdown mode signals continuously as water level falls below the probe
- Same P7 probe and laser-marked PVDF flat tape as the standard 101 meter
- Accurate to every millimeter or 1/100 ft
- Submersible probe and tape rated -20°C to +80°C
- Available in lengths up to 1500 m (SC4500 reel configuration)
- Continuous drawdown monitoring during pumping tests
- Well development and purging
- Slug, step, and hydraulic conductivity testing
- Dewatering monitoring during construction
- Standard depth-to-water measurement
- Aquifer testing programs
